The default volume levels on my laptop (75:75) are rather loud when using
headphones, and I found myself constantly having to pop up a terminal window
to run mixer before listening to mp3's, etc. So, during a fit of boredom, I
wrote a simple mixer rc.d script that adjusts mixer values based on an
optional /etc/mixer.conf. It only works with /dev/mixer though and doesn't
support multiple sound cards, mostly because I couldn't think of a sane but
simple syntax for mixer.conf. The script and a sample mixer.conf are below.
I'm not sure where to send this for review (moving the rc list to
@FreeBSD.org would be helpful perhaps) so I'm splatting it here.

# PROVIDE: mixer
# REQUIRE: LOGIN usbd
# KEYWORD: FreeBSD
. /etc/rc.subr
name="mixer"
stop_cmd=":"
start_cmd="mixer_start"
reload_cmd="mixer_start"
extra_commands="reload"
mixer_start()
{
#
# Read in /etc/mixer.conf and set things accordingly
#
if [ -f /etc/mixer.conf -a -r /dev/mixer ]; then
while read mixer comments
do
case ${mixer} in
\#*|'')
;;
*)
dev=${mixer%=*}
val=${mixer#*=}
case ${val} in
*:*)
;;
*)
val=${val}:${val}
;;
esac
if current_value=`mixer ${dev} 2>/dev/null`; then
current_value=`echo ${current_value} |\
awk '{ print $7 }'`
case ${current_value} in
${val})
;;
*)
mixer ${dev} ${val}
;;
esac
else
warn "mixer ${dev} does not exist."
fi
;;
esac
done < /etc/mixer.conf
fi
}
load_rc_config $name
run_rc_command "$1"
---- mixer.conf
# $FreeBSD$
#
# Sound mixer settings.
vol=40 # not too loud, please!
pcm=50
